In an era when scientific discovery shapes our collective future, a new movement is rising to transform how research is funded, conducted, and shared. Decentralized Science, or DeSci, harnesses the power of blockchain, DAOs, smart contracts, and tokens to break down traditional barriers and build a community-driven, transparent scientific ecosystem accessible to all.
Why DeSci Matters
Traditional science operates behind paywalls, lengthy grant cycles, and centralized gatekeepers. Groundbreaking ideas can languish for years before receiving funding, while data remains siloed and inaccessible. DeSci challenges this model by creating public infrastructure for open research that rewards collaboration, accelerates peer review, and safeguards integrity.
By leveraging decentralized ledgers, DeSci ensures transparency at every stage and processes that are resistant to censorship and bias. Open ledgers replace opaque funding decisions with on-chain votes, while smart contracts automate agreements between researchers, institutions, and backers. The result is a system designed to serve the global scientific community rather than a handful of powerful entities.
Core Technologies and Mechanisms
At the heart of DeSci lie several key innovations that reimagine research workflows:
- Blockchain/DLT: Provides immutable, verifiable blockchain records of data, methods, and findings to ensure trust and reproducibility.
- Decentralized Autonomous Organizations: Empowers communities to govern funding, peer review, and project selection through transparent token-holder voting.
- Tokens, IP-NFTs, and SBTs: Tokenize intellectual property and contributions to incentivize peer review contributions and accurately credit every participant.
- Smart Contracts: Automate funding disbursements, publication triggers, and reward distributions to minimize delays and human error.
Additional tools, such as decentralized storage networks and AI-driven matching algorithms, further enhance the DeSci environment by providing scalable compute power and expert connections on demand.
Real-World Impact and Projects
Since its inception, DeSci has moved from theoretical frameworks to tangible outcomes. A growing roster of projects demonstrates how decentralized approaches can accelerate breakthroughs and democratize opportunity.
- VitaDAO: A longevity research DAO where community members vote on which anti-aging studies to fund, backed by major institutions.
- ResearchHub: An open research platform that streamlines preprint sharing and rewards reviewers with tokens.
- Patient-owned data networks and small-scale clinical trials that place control in participants’ hands, fostering innovation in rare disease research.
Recent funding rounds have mobilized millions of dollars in funding across more than forty DeSci initiatives, spanning biotech, climate science, and global health.

Challenges and Limitations
Despite its promise, DeSci faces hurdles that must be addressed to achieve mainstream adoption. First, there is a steep learning curve for newcomers unfamiliar with blockchain tools and governance models. Without user-friendly interfaces and educational resources, many scientists remain hesitant.
Second, the volatility of crypto markets introduces risk into research budgets, highlighting the need for stable funding mechanisms. Third, open governance raises questions about maintaining rigorous scientific standards and preventing low-quality publications.
Finally, regulatory and ethical frameworks must evolve to accommodate decentralized ownership of data and intellectual property. Successfully navigating regulatory and ethical landscapes will be crucial to sustaining trust among participants and institutions.
